Description

A fine and impressive vintage 4.43 carat garnet and 18 carat yellow gold dress ring; part of our diverse collection of vintage rings.

This fine and impressive vintage garnet ring has been crafted in 18ct yellow gold.

The oval shaped ring setting displays a millegrain decorated collet set 4.43ct cabochon cut garnet.

This impressive feature stone is encompassed with a scrolling yellow gold designs, replicating the details of an antique 1830s ring.

The bifurcating ring shoulders conjoin at a collar design and meld to a plain ring shank.

This vintage gold garnet ring has been independently tested using state of the art technology (Niton XL2 Analyzer) and verified as 18ct gold.

This impressive ring is supplied with an IDGL gemstone grading report card.

Images do not always reflect the true colour and brilliance of gemstones and diamonds. The video however provides a truer representation of the actual colour and showcases each stone.

Condition

This vintage ring is excellent quality, set with an impressive garnet displaying fine colour, brilliance and presence.

The ring is an excellent gauge of gold and is in excellent condition.

The original hallmarks to the interior of the shank have worn in keeping with age and are illegible.

Retro era jewellery from the 1940s is defined by bold geometric forms, sculptural goldwork, and prominent central gemstones. Influenced by wartime metal restrictions and changing fashions, designers favoured yellow gold and large cabochon or step-cut gemstones to create striking statement pieces.

Rings from this period commonly featured high-purity gold, such as 18ct yellow gold, paired with polished cabochon garnets or deep red semiprecious stones. Metalwork often incorporated pierced, stamped, or turned decorative borders alongside split shanks.

Authentic pieces display period-appropriate hallmarks indicating metal purity, distinct maker marks, and evidence of hand-finishing along internal edges. The gemstones typically feature classic mid-century cuts, such as smooth cabochons, set securely within bezel or claw mounts.

A vintage dress ring serves as a focal piece when paired with minimalist contemporary tailoring or evening wear. It is typically worn individually on the right hand to highlight the detailed goldwork without visual competition from other accessories.

Clean the ring using warm water, mild soap, and a soft-bristled brush, avoiding harsh chemical solutions or ultrasonic devices. Store the piece in a fabric-lined jewellery box separately from hard objects to prevent surface scratching on the gold and gemstone.
